1. 0.7 acre lot for sale in Birmingham Alabama for $16268. Nice homes in neighborhood.

    0.7 acre lot for sale in Birmingham Alabama for $16268. Nice homes in neighborhood.

    4
  2. 🏡 Discover Mountain Brook, Alabama: Your Dream Home Awaits! 🌳✨

    🏡 Discover Mountain Brook, Alabama: Your Dream Home Awaits! 🌳✨

    2